I have a EKS cluster which servers publicly available end points. However, i want to now add an end point which should only be accessible in the same VPC. How can i achieve something like this in EKS. For example, let a service A only be accessible from within the same VPC.
is this possible to natively achieve in EKS (Kubernetes) where I can place the Lambda in the same VPC as EKS cluster and then only allow communication between the two. I dont want the end point to be available publicly. I don't think i can use ClusterIP service as it only lets resources inside the cluster communicate. can I use a different service type to let service be accessible in only a VPC.
Any help here would be really great, Thanks.
If you already have an AWSLBController, deploy an ingress with internal load balancer annotations.
Then your lambda in the same VPC may reach this load balancer.
Additionally, I would choose to set up a private hosted zone in Route53 as opposed to setting up a DNS record with a load balancer's CNAME value. Because load balancer DNS name is difficult to memorize,
